Gift Aid
If you're a UK taxpayer please take advantage of the UK Government's Gift Aid Scheme by completing the Gift Aid Form. This will enable us to reclaim the basic rate tax you have paid on any gifts you make to us-that's a further £25 on a gift of £100 at no further cost to you.
You only need to complete this form once, then as long as we know the giving is from you, we can reclaim.
